ULYSSES develops a portable biosensor for early detection of breast and prostate cancers using urine analysis. It mimics the olfactory system of the nematode Caenorhabditis elegans to identify cancer-related compounds with high accuracy, aiming for a significant impact on health monitoring and personalized medicine.
ULYSSES is a pioneering project aimed at developing a non-invasive, portable, and user-friendly biosensor for the early detection of breast and prostate cancers through urine analysis.
Its core vision is to identify cancer-related volatile organic compounds (VOCs) and develop a biotechnological device for their detection in urine.
